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/ Firebird, InterBase [игнор отключен] [закрыт для гостей] / Выборы фич / 16 сообщений из 16, страница 1 из 1
25.04.2015, 12:52
    #38945177
Dimitry Sibiryakov
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Выборы фич
В сами-знаете-каком репликаторе скопилась такая куча фич, что каждая следующая рушит всё. Поэтому обращаюсь к сообществу: выберите из списка одну фичу, которой точно не будет в следующей версии. Поскольку вместе они жить не могут.
...
Рейтинг: 0 / 0
25.04.2015, 13:10
    #38945186
Dimitry Sibiryakov
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Выборы фич
Чтобы ещё затруднить выбор, опишу плюшки от каждой фичи:

Первая сильно уменьшает размер логов в которые не будут попадать неизменённые блобы,
например. Кроме того, решается проблема потерянных изменений при двунаправленной репликации.

Вторая уменьшает затраты на начальное конфигурирование: указали источник, приёмник и...
всё, погнали.

Третья позволяет в консолидированной БД иметь больше полей и/или другую структуру
первичного ключа.
Posted via ActualForum NNTP Server 1.5
...
Рейтинг: 0 / 0
25.04.2015, 13:11
    #38945187
Gallemar
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Выборы фич
блин,Дима, не то выбрал :( поставил 1 вместо 3
...
Рейтинг: 0 / 0
25.04.2015, 13:19
    #38945190
Gallemar
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Выборы фич
Dimitry SibiryakovВторая уменьшает затраты на начальное конфигурирование: указали источник, приёмник и...
всё, погнали.

А если в таблицах ПК нету? Как будет конфигурироваться в этом случае?
Метод "указали источник, приёмник и... всё, погнали" есть в CopyCat, который я так и не поборол, несмотря на помощь Джонатана. После "сами-знаете-каком репликатора" выглядело это мракобесием.
...
Рейтинг: 0 / 0
25.04.2015, 13:31
    #38945195
Dimitry Sibiryakov
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Выборы фич
GallemarА если в таблицах ПК нету? Как будет конфигурироваться в этом случае?

Никак. Будет ошибка. Ибо у таблицы первичный ключ быть обязан.
Posted via ActualForum NNTP Server 1.5
...
Рейтинг: 0 / 0
25.04.2015, 13:36
    #38945198
Gallemar
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Выборы фич
Dimitry Sibiryakov,кому обязан?:) А если я специально не хочу индексировать? Для таких таблиц таки нужен будет суррогатный ПК?
...
Рейтинг: 0 / 0
25.04.2015, 13:39
    #38945200
Dimitry Sibiryakov
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Выборы фич
Gallemarкому обязан?
Мне обязан. Не хочешь реплицировать - не реплицируй. Хочешь реплицировать - будь любезен
иметь первичный ключ.
Posted via ActualForum NNTP Server 1.5
...
Рейтинг: 0 / 0
25.04.2015, 13:55
    #38945208
Gallemar
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Выборы фич
Dimitry Sibiryakov,ладно, с ПК это решаемо. А если мне нужно реплицировать 2-3 таблицы (для сверки в 1с,оно так шустрее работает), а не все подряд, как в этом случае быть, если всё автоматически?
...
Рейтинг: 0 / 0
25.04.2015, 13:58
    #38945209
Dimitry Sibiryakov
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Выборы фич
GallemarА если мне нужно реплицировать 2-3 таблицы (для сверки в 1с,оно так шустрее
работает), а не все подряд, как в этом случае быть, если всё автоматически?

Код: sql
1.
2.
ALTER TABLE TABLE1 ENABLE REPLICATION;
ALTER TABLE TABLE2 ENABLE REPLICATION;


Всё, дальше оно само.
Posted via ActualForum NNTP Server 1.5
...
Рейтинг: 0 / 0
25.04.2015, 14:02
    #38945210
Gallemar
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Выборы фич
Dimitry Sibiryakov,понятно. Потестить потом дашь?
...
Рейтинг: 0 / 0
25.04.2015, 14:58
    #38945226
Таблоид
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Выборы фич
Выбрал жертвой пункт номер 1. Ибо размер лога в век дешёвых петабайтов не имеет значения.
Кроме того, страницы лога этого всё равно бесконца высвобождаются при очередном коммите.

А вот пункт номер три - не трожь!! Если у мну в БД-1 поле названо 'COST', а в БД-2 его имя - 'STOIMOST', то что теперь - не реплицировать что ле ?!
...
Рейтинг: 0 / 0
25.04.2015, 15:31
    #38945244
Dimitry Sibiryakov
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Выборы фич
Таблоидпункт номер три - не трожь!! Если у мну в БД-1 поле названо 'COST', а в БД-2
его имя - 'STOIMOST', то что теперь - не реплицировать что ле ?!
Реплицировать. Но тебе придётся в настройках БД пункт 2 отключить и схему целиком создать
руками.
Posted via ActualForum NNTP Server 1.5
...
Рейтинг: 0 / 0
25.04.2015, 15:37
    #38945245
Таблоид
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Выборы фич
Dimitry Sibiryakovпридётся в настройках БД пункт 2 отключить и схему целиком создать
руками.А почему нельзя сохранить так, как сейчас: чтобы соответствие "протягивалось" по совпадающим ИМЕНАМ полей, а различающиеся - хрен с ними, сам доделаю ?
...
Рейтинг: 0 / 0
25.04.2015, 15:53
    #38945253
Dimitry Sibiryakov
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Выборы фич
ТаблоидА почему нельзя сохранить так, как сейчас: чтобы соответствие
"протягивалось" по совпадающим ИМЕНАМ полей, а различающиеся - хрен с ними, сам доделаю ?

Как (когда) доделаешь? Это фичи времени репликации, а не её конфигурирования. Репликация -
автоматический процесс, происходящий без вмешательства админа.
Posted via ActualForum NNTP Server 1.5
...
Рейтинг: 0 / 0
25.04.2015, 16:41
    #38945265
Таблоид
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Выборы фич
Dimitry SibiryakovТаблоидА почему нельзя сохранить так, как сейчас: чтобы соответствие
"протягивалось" по совпадающим ИМЕНАМ полей, а различающиеся - хрен с ними, сам доделаю ?

Как (когда) доделаешь? Это фичи времени репликации, а не её конфигурирования. Репликация -
автоматический процесс, происходящий без вмешательства админа.
Не могу сейчас подключиться к машине с конфигуратором репликатора, но отчётливо помню: там можно было что-то жмякнуть и он искал совпадающие поля в одноименных (или сопоставленных) таблицах и всё прочее соотв-вие ставилось очень быстро.
...
Рейтинг: 0 / 0
25.04.2015, 16:53
    #38945269
Dimitry Sibiryakov
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Выборы фич
ТаблоидНе могу сейчас подключиться к машине с конфигуратором репликатора, но
отчётливо помню: там можно было что-то жмякнуть и он искал совпадающие поля в одноименных
(или сопоставленных) таблицах и всё прочее соотв-вие ставилось очень быстро.
Это совсем-совсем другая фича.
Posted via ActualForum NNTP Server 1.5
...
Рейтинг: 0 / 0
Форумы / Firebird, InterBase [игнор отключен] [закрыт для гостей] / Выборы фич / 16 сообщений из 16,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]